117.info
人生若只如初见

oracle迁移的最佳实践是什么

Oracle迁移是一个复杂的过程,需要仔细规划和执行。以下是一些Oracle迁移的最佳实践:

  1. 确定迁移目标:在开始迁移之前,定义清晰的目标和要求。确定迁移的原因和目标是什么?是为了降低成本、提高性能还是采用新的技术?

  2. 进行评估和规划:在开始迁移之前,进行全面的评估和规划。评估当前的Oracle环境,包括数据库大小、性能和配置。制定详细的迁移计划,包括时间表、资源和风险管理。

  3. 选择适当的迁移方法:根据迁移的规模和复杂性,选择合适的迁移方法。可以选择逐步迁移、并行迁移、升级迁移或云迁移等方法。

  4. 在测试环境进行测试:在实际迁移之前,在测试环境进行充分的测试。确保迁移过程是可靠的,并且不会影响生产环境。

  5. 数据备份和恢复:在进行迁移之前,务必进行全面的数据备份。在迁移过程中,随时准备好进行数据恢复。

  6. 迁移后的优化:在迁移完成后,进行数据库性能优化和调整。检查数据库配置、索引和存储布局,以确保数据库的性能和稳定性。

  7. 持续监控和维护:迁移完成后,需要持续监控数据库的性能和稳定性。及时识别和解决问题,确保数据库的正常运行。

总的来说,Oracle迁移需要仔细的规划和执行,遵循最佳实践可以确保迁移的顺利进行并达到预期的效果。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e9c7AzsIBQFSAVU.html

推荐文章

  • oracle存储过程是什么

    Oracle存储过程是一组预先编译的SQL语句和逻辑操作的集合,它们一起执行特定的任务。存储过程在数据库中存储并可以通过名称进行调用,以便在需要时重复使用。存储...

  • oracle游标怎么使用

    Oracle游标用于在PL/SQL中处理查询语句的结果集。以下是使用Oracle游标的一般步骤: 声明游标:在PL/SQL块中使用CURSOR关键字声明游标,指定查询语句和游标名称。...

  • oracle分页查询数据的方法是什么

    在Oracle中,可以使用ROWNUM和ROWID来实现分页查询数据。 使用ROWNUM方法: 使用ROWNUM可以将查询到的结果按照行数进行排序,然后再根据需要取出指定的行数。 例...

  • oracle number精度丢失怎么解决

    在Oracle数据库中,浮点数的精度丢失问题可以通过以下几种方法解决: 使用NUMBER数据类型的参数和变量:Oracle数据库中的NUMBER数据类型可以指定精度和标度,通过...

  • oracle迁移后如何快速恢复业务

    迁移Oracle数据库后,如果需要快速恢复业务,可以按照以下步骤进行操作: 备份数据:在迁移前务必备份数据,以防发生意外情况。可以使用Oracle的备份工具或者第三...

  • hashmap默认大小如何修改

    在Java中,HashMap的默认大小是16,可以通过调用HashMap的构造函数并传入指定的初始容量来修改HashMap的大小。例如,可以通过以下方式修改HashMap的大小为32:

  • hashmap默认大小会影响性能吗

    是的,HashMap的默认大小会影响性能。如果HashMap的默认大小不合适,可能会导致哈希冲突增多,导致查找、插入、删除等操作的性能下降。因此,为了获得更好的性能...

  • java打印pdf能设置密码吗

    在Java中打印PDF时,可以通过使用第三方库来设置密码来保护PDF文件。例如,可以使用iText库来创建密码保护的PDF文件。以下是一个简单的示例代码:
    import c...